Canada, CEF. A 65th Infantry Battalion "Saskatchewan Battalion" Cap Badge, by R.J.Inglis Republic of the obverse consisting of aIn pickled copper, voided, maker marked "R. J. INGLIS LIMITED" on the reverse, measuring 37. 3 mm (w) x 45 mm (h), both lugs intact, surface wear and contact marks evident on the obverse, better than very fine. Footnote: The Battalion was raised in Saskatchewan and Manitoba under the authority of G. O. 103A, August 15, 1915. The mobilization headquarters was at Saskatoon, Saskatchewan.
